什么是GitHub开源机械?
GitHub开源机械是指在GitHub平台上发布的与机械相关的开源项目。这些项目涵盖了从机械设计、仿真到控制系统等多个领域,提供了丰富的资源和工具,促进了机械工程师和开发者之间的合作与创新。
GitHub开源机械的优势
- 开放性:任何人都可以查看、使用和修改这些项目。
- 社区支持:开发者和爱好者可以在GitHub上分享他们的经验与技术。
- 成本效益:使用开源机械项目可以大幅降低开发成本。
- 快速迭代:借助社区的力量,项目更新与迭代更加迅速。
如何查找GitHub上的开源机械项目
- 使用关键词搜索:在GitHub的搜索框中输入“机械”、“机器人”或“仿真”等关键词。
- 筛选标签:使用GitHub的标签功能筛选相关项目,如“开源”、“机器人”、“3D打印”等。
- 关注热门项目:查看GitHub上的热门开源机械项目,以了解行业趋势和先进技术。
GitHub开源机械的热门项目
1. ROS(Robot Operating System)
- 简介:ROS是一个开源的机器人操作系统,提供了大量的工具和库,广泛应用于机器人开发。
- 链接:ROS GitHub Repository
2. OpenSCAD
- 简介:OpenSCAD是一个免费的3D CAD建模软件,适合机械工程师使用。
- 链接:OpenSCAD GitHub Repository
3. Arduino
- 简介:Arduino是一个开源电子原型平台,适合各种机械控制项目。
- 链接:Arduino GitHub Repository
4. FreeCAD
- 简介:FreeCAD是一个开源的3D建模工具,特别适用于机械工程和产品设计。
- 链接:FreeCAD GitHub Repository
开源机械在教育中的应用
- 学生项目:通过GitHub上的开源机械项目,学生可以获得实际操作经验。
- 教学资源:教师可以使用这些项目作为教学材料,提高学生的兴趣。
- 竞赛与合作:学生可以参与开源项目,积累团队合作和解决实际问题的能力。
开源机械的未来发展趋势
- 智能化:随着人工智能技术的发展,开源机械项目将逐渐融入更多智能化功能。
- 标准化:行业标准的制定将使得开源机械项目更加规范,提高互操作性。
- 跨领域融合:开源机械将与其他领域(如电子、软件等)进一步融合,推动多学科交叉合作。
FAQ(常见问题解答)
GitHub开源机械是什么?
GitHub开源机械是指在GitHub上发布的与机械相关的开源项目,包含设计、仿真、控制等多种资源。
如何参与GitHub开源机械项目?
你可以通过在GitHub上找到相关项目,克隆代码、贡献代码、报告问题或进行文档撰写等方式参与其中。
GitHub上有哪些著名的开源机械项目?
著名的项目包括ROS、OpenSCAD、Arduino和FreeCAD等,这些项目在各自领域都有广泛的应用。
开源机械项目适合哪些人群?
开源机械项目适合学生、教育工作者、专业机械工程师以及任何对机械技术感兴趣的开发者。
如何找到适合的开源机械项目?
你可以通过关键词搜索、查看热门项目以及利用GitHub的标签筛选功能来找到适合的开源机械项目。
正文完